Nderitu: Everyone in BiH deserves a future in which there is no space for denial of genocide

FENA Press release, Photo: Arhiv

NEW YORK, April 3 (FENA) - The United Nations Special Adviser on the Prevention of Genocide, Alice Wairimu Nderita, welcomed the amendments to the Election Law of Bosnia and Herzegovina that the High Representative in Bosnia and Herzegovina, Christian Schmidt, imposed at the end of last month, which stipulate that "no person who has been convicted by any international or domestic court of the crimes of genocide, crimes against humanity or war crimes may stand as candidate for elections or hold any elective, appointive or other office".
